The meeting of the leaders of Armenia and Azerbaijan in Washington, with the mediation of the US President, deserves a positive assessment, although until recently Baku and Yerevan claimed that they prefer to conduct a dialogue without external assistance, Russian Foreign Ministry spokeswoman Maria Zakharova said today, August 9.
She recalled that the current stage of the Armenian-Azerbaijani normalization started with the direct assistance and central role of Russia with the adoption of the trilateral High-level Statement of November 9, 2020 on the ceasefire and all hostilities in the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ict zone. In 2020-2022, a "road map" was developed in the same trilateral format in all key areas of reconciliation between Baku and Yerevan.
The best option for solving the problems of the South Caucasus is to find and further implement solutions developed by the countries of the region themselves with the support of their immediate neighbors — Russia, Iran, Turkey. The involvement of non-regional players should work to strengthen the peace agenda and not create additional difficulties and dividing lines, Zakharova stressed.
"I would like to avoid the sad experience of Western assistance in resolving conflicts in the Middle East. One of the examples in the South Caucasus is the presence of the EU observation mission in Armenia, whose activities constantly irritate other regionals," Zakharova recalled.
The Russian Foreign Ministry promised to further analyze "Washington's statements regarding the unblocking of regional communications."
"Trilateral agreements with the participation of Russia remain relevant in this area, from which none of the parties has withdrawn. It is also important to take into account the factor of Armenia's membership in the common customs space of the EAEU, in particular, with regard to the organization of transit cargo transportation through the territory of the republic. It is impossible to ignore the fact that Armenia's border with Iran is guarded by Russian border guards stationed in accordance with the interstate agreement of September 30, 1992," Zakharova said.
